Transaction d715a75bb40fd514462a862aa5dae95cb1f4ce4649190aec57f99fa7eb22cc41
1 Input
2 Outputs
- d715a75bb40fd514462a862aa5dae95cb1f4ce4649190aec57f99fa7eb22cc41:0
- d715a75bb40fd514462a862aa5dae95cb1f4ce4649190aec57f99fa7eb22cc41:1
value 1431516
address 1PuhVTDrR9ERu1jvnmfLLut9jYBEcoYTPX
value 1867419889
address 3HgqecBrZCqq3d7WdS3D96BmQXynp4AedK